No matter the time in the game, the score or situation as a hitter we are prepared to battle and make every at bat count. We do this by ensuring;
KEEP THE HEAD STILL. You can’t hit what you can’t see.
KNOW THE SITUATION. Identify the situation and execute situational hitting.
MULTIPLE AT BATS. Before we enter the batter’s box, we have already had multiple at bats. Before we get on deck we watch, we talk to team mates and we take at bats. On deck we take more at bats, getting our timing right and watching the pitchers release. We take multiple at bats so we are not surprised when we enter the batter’s box.
EVERY PITCH WE ARE READY TO HIT. No matter where we are in the game or what the count is, we have the mindset that we are ready to swing and decide not to swing. We do not have the mentality that we have already decided we will not swing before the pitch. Be ready and drive that fastball, be aggressive.
SWING HARD. Every time we swing the bat we swing hard, our aim is to drive the ball past fielders. Because we are prepared and ready to hit, this becomes natural as we are never fooled or decide too late to swing.
PUT THE BALL IN PLAY. Let’s make the defence get us out, don’t give the pitcher an easy out. We want to not only put the ball in play every at bat, but we want to hit it hard.
GOOD 2 STRIKE APPROACH. Be tough with 2. Give up the inside corner and look away. Get ready to hit early (minimise movement). Stay on the fastball. Use the opposite field (stay inside the ball) and aim for it to be either ball or barrel.
